摘要:Almost half of the world’s industries and production is done by using stainless steel. It is not easy tomachine materials their high strength, high ductile and low thermal conductivity. This paper discuss the influence oftool wear and drilling time of SS316L(Stainless steel) & AA6085 (Aluminum alloy)factor like spindle speed, feed rateaffect the performance parameter with various cutting environment such as Normal castor oil mix with water. Thispaper present the multi-objective optimization of drilling process parameter using Orthogonal Array method inmachining of SS316L (Stainless steel) & AA 6085 (Aluminum alloy). The main aim is to find out the minimum toolwear and machining time of drilling SS316L (Stainless steel) & AA6085 (Aluminum Alloy). The experiments areconducted based L9 orthogonal array by taking machining time, feed rate and spindle speed at three level. Theorthogonal array analysis is used to obtain the relation between the machining parameters and performancecharacteristics.
